Resumo
This research examines the notion of "being a teacher" based on experiences of training and professional expectations of a group of students in the Visual Arts Teacher Training Program at the Federal University of Amapá. The investigation has its focus on questions that permeate and afflict the initial training of teachers, specifically related to the construction of a teaching identity. The study assumes that students and teachers should be heard on these issues, considering that ways of seeing, learning and apprehending meanings about reality are crossed by discourses and imagery processes. Thus, the meanings students attribute to the idea of being a teacher" can help understand aspects of how their teaching identities are constructed and represented. Qualitative research, with its descriptive and interpretive characteristics, is the methodological approach chosen for this study. The data was collected through open interviews, focus groups, images and field notes.
